Development of a Scalable Synthesis of (S)-3-Fluoromethyl-γ-butyrolactone, Building Block for Carmegliptin’s Lactam Moiety
摘要:
Several new routes are reported for the synthesis of (S)-3-fluoromethyl-gamma-butyrolactone. An asymmetric hydrogenation-based synthesis was chosen as the enabling route to produce the lactone on a 10-kg scale. A superior stereoselective route starting from (S)-tert-butyl glycidyl ether which afforded the desired lactone in three steps with similar to 50% overall yield was finally selected for further development and production.

[EN] PROCESS FOR THE PREPARATION OF (S)-4-FLUOROMETHYL-DIHYDRO-FURAN-2-ONE<br/>[FR] PROCÉDÉ DE PRÉPARATION DE LA (S)-4-FLUOROMÉTHYL-DIHYDRO-FURAN-2-ONE
申请人:HOFFMANN LA ROCHE
公开号:WO2008055814A2
公开(公告)日:2008-05-15
[EN] The present invention relates to a process of the preparation of (S)-4-fluoromethyl-dihydro-furan-2-one of the formula (I) by employing a dialkylmalonate of the formula (V) wherein R1b is lower alkyl, and the use of this process for the manufacture of DPP-IV inhibitors that are useful for the treatment and/or prophylaxis of diseases such as diabetes.
